Permit Authority

The town issues both zoning and building permits locally.

Department
Town of Union zoning and building permit administration
Address
425 Water Street, Evansville, WI 53536
Phone
Town hall 608-302-8676; permit contact Bob Fahey 608-882-6267

Online Permit Portal

Platform: Town forms and permits page • Account required: No • Submission: In-person only

Application Process

  1. Obtain the zoning and building permit materials from the town.
  2. Submit plans and site information to the town permit contact.
  3. Pay fees when assigned.
  4. Wait for permit approval before starting work.
  5. Schedule inspections through Bob Fahey.
  6. Obtain final approval after project completion.

General Requirements

Town public routing states both zoning and building permits are issued by the town

Required Documents

  • Town permit forms, plans, and site information
Building code
Town-administered local zoning and Wisconsin state building code enforcement
Contractor requirements
Wisconsin licensing rules apply where applicable
